How old was Altair Ibn LaʼAhad when he died?
He lived from 1165 to 1257, and his remains were found in the Masyaf Castle library by the Italian Assassin Ezio Auditore da Firenze in 1512. Though his face can be somewhat seen in the original Assassin’s Creed, it is fully revealed in Assassin’s Creed: Revelations when he is older.
How old was Altair when he became an assassin?
Raised to be an Assassin from birth, Altaïr became a Master Assassin at age 24, an accomplishment unheard of for one so young. He failed to recover an Apple of Eden from Robert de Sablé in July 1191 and subsequently allowed the Templars to attack the town of Masyaf, headquarters of the Assassins.

Why did Altair want to change his ways?
Tasked with the deaths of nine individuals who, unbeknownst to him, made up the ranks of the Templar Order in the Holy Land, Altaïr began a quest to change his ways and liberate the Kingdom from their corruption. During his quest, however, Altaïr learned of a plot far more sinister than he originally believed.
How does Ezio get Altair’s memories from Altair?
Ezio discovers that five locks seal the door to the library, and that five ‘Masyaf keys’ must be found in order to open the library. Whenever Ezio finds a Masyaf key, he inadvertently accesses one of Altaïr’s memories – deliberately stored inside each key.
What assassin creed is Altair in?
Altaïr Ibn-La’Ahad is the main protagonist of Assassin’s Creed, as well as a minor protagonist in Assassin’s Creed II, and the deuteragonist in Assassin’s Creed: Revelations. He was a Syrian Assassin during the Middle Ages and, from 1191 until his death, the Mentor of the Assassins in the Levant.

What is Eden in Assassin’s Creed?
Eden, or the Garden of Eden, was an ancient city built by the Isu. The city was home to Phanes, a leading scientist in Project Anthropos, a programme designed to develop a resiliant, docile workforce enslaved to the Isu by way of the Pieces of Eden.
